Qutrabbul Gate

The Qutrabbul Gate was one of the Gates of Baghdad, located in the northwest of Harbiyah district, near the Dyeing Factory of Shari'.

In the 860s, the Alamut Hidden Ones Fuladh Al Haami, Roshan, and Basim Ibn Ishaq left their mountain fortress and entered the city of Baghdad through the gate before heading to establish a bureau in the region.[1]
